sti steering rack bolts and bushings

I can not get the stock steering rack bushings out. Anybody have good ideas? I saw somebody use a C clamp but I do not that have. I am also trying to do the sti longer bolts and those I could not even get in. It feels like they want to cross thread, and so I put the stock ones back in. Anybody have a hard time with these as well?

I put my STI bolts in at the same time as my Whiteline bushings. A little bit of "stiction" going in, but I made sure I cleaned the far end of the bolt holes (at the front end of the subframe holes) and it was fine - start by hand until I was sure it was on the thread then handtools till tight.
